Output 3291fa78402dddb47beb6027f101c64be90f2b1a4074d63669141a4a3f589072:0

value
308759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19edd5d72da99ba0460307a2942843d04fbfd4df OP_EQUAL
address
3447jRiGdKKafxMx6KCciPMHHQn61gUPsr
transaction
3291fa78402dddb47beb6027f101c64be90f2b1a4074d63669141a4a3f589072
spent
true